He made this know in the interview he granted with a BBC News reporter in Abuja Nigeria a few days ago, where he made it clear and voiceful that if the government can secure Nigeria, they should be no votes come 2023


Imam Sheik Nuru Khalid is also addressed as the Digital Imam. As he passes a strong message to the Nigeria government and those in politics. He asks Nigeria government to quickly move and do something fast in other to save lives and properties in Nigeria, people are dying, the death rate is too much, he said

It's more important to save Nigeria, his messages focus on Nigeria's Unity, which he said should come first, not how a politician will win the next election, gain more power and continue to use the power to oppress innocent Nigerians,

The Imam also made it clear that it was never his intention to bring this matter to the media houses, but the government pushed him to do so, the government pushes me to the wall, by being the first to take the matter to the media, so you don't expect them to go to the media, to the Nigeria public and talk bad about me, lie in my name, for such doings, I also need have to use the media to bring the truth to the public


And again you can't say because I'm Imam so I should close my mouth, I should not talk even when innocent Nigerians are dying in mass, no is a no to me, everyone has his or her right, the same way I have right to talk, so I'm saying to Nigerians if the government can't provide security for Nigerians there should be no vote
